Expansion modules
Two expansion modules are available to increase library capacity beyond that provided by the base
module. These expansions modules are:
Tape drive expansion module.
Card cage expansion module.
Tape drive expansion module
The tape drive expansion module (see Figure 11) is an 8U chassis containing 94 LTO slots (84
permanent and 10 configurable). The number of usable slots depends on whether it is the lowest module
vertically placed in the library. If the library floor is attached to this module, the bottom row (containing
seven slots) is blocked and cannot be used.
The tape drive expansion module has three windows on the front for viewing the robotic motion inside the
library. To the right is a 10-cartridge configurable load port that holds two 5-cartridge magazines.
On the back, the module contains one primary power supply with a slot provided for another optional
redundant power supply. Up to four HP Ultrium tape drives can be installed on the module. Cable
management features are provided for cable routing and dressing.
